This sweet Xmas quilt “Frosties Friends” is Lyn Madden’s too. It was a block swap with friends. Each made 1 Frostie, 1 Star and 5 Nine Patch Blocks.

Margaret Rapson winner of Marie Finegan Award

Margaret's quilt won the "Marie Finegan Award"

Marie Finegan was a well loved Club Member who passed away last year. Marie's Husband Derek & Daughter Diane, picked a quilt in the show that they thought Marie would have loved.

Derek Finegan & Diane Anson Judges of the Marie Finegan Award.
Derek & Diane with Margaret's quilt.
